Hacker News new | ask | show | jobs
by robertlagrant 1036 days ago
If a civil engineer is given specific instructions to make an unsafe bridge, that engineer does not obey those instructions. I think adult developers should behave similarly.
1 comments

The analogy starts to break down. Most software is less mission-critical than the structural integrity of a bridge. Meaning the consequences for failure are probably annoyance rather than risk of death. Not always. I would imagine the software for nuclear reactor or aircraft controls is in a different category, but most software is not bridges.
Okay, but if developers decide that then at what point do you say it's okay to not treat them like adults?